Output 1b3b6d15a60eb31f74eef6bfc88b56f3b9b5893d61b8cde749749c17cb6267d7:1

value
17764500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eb83e2b9386b4361497f16ba85532b68269594e OP_EQUAL
address
34VSuiWUq81UoiGMmbmkjp7BU5Mn8riA4Y
transaction
1b3b6d15a60eb31f74eef6bfc88b56f3b9b5893d61b8cde749749c17cb6267d7
confirmations
339380
spent
true